Solution

The correct option is D Both Assertion and Reason are incorrect
Decomposition of KClO3:
2KClO32KCl+3O2

Decomposition of HgO:
2HgO2Hg+O2

From the above equations, equal no. of moles of KClO3 and HgO produces different no. of moles of oxygen.

Since stoichiometry of reactants depends upon the balanced chemical equation.

Hence both Assertion and Reason are incorrect.
